Limits of Quantization in AI Models: Trade-offs and Challenges

Limits of Quantization in AI Models: Trade-offs and Challenges

The Limits of AI Model Quantization: A Closer Look

In AI, quantization is a method used to improve model efficiency. It reduces the number of bits needed to represent data, making models more computationally efficient. However, this technique has its limitations, and we may be reaching the point where it no longer offers significant benefits.

What is Quantization in AI?

Quantization refers to lowering the precision of data used by AI models. It’s like rounding a number to fewer decimal places — reducing complexity but maintaining most of the original information. In AI, this usually means reducing the bit count in a model’s parameters, which are the internal variables the model uses for decision-making.

Quantization helps reduce the computational demands of AI models, especially during inference. Inference is the phase where a trained model answers questions or makes predictions. By reducing the number of bits used, quantized models require less processing power and memory, making them cheaper to run.

The Trade-offs of Quantization

While quantization is an effective tool for reducing model size and computational demands, it may come with performance trade-offs. Recent research from institutions like Harvard and MIT highlights that quantization can negatively impact models trained on large datasets over extended periods. For these large models, quantization may cause more harm than good, reducing their overall performance.

In these cases, it might actually be more beneficial to train smaller models from the start rather than quantizing large models. Smaller models tend to be less prone to the issues associated with extreme quantization.

How Quantization Impacts AI Models

The real challenge with quantization arises when a model has been trained on vast datasets. AI labs like Meta have trained large models such as Llama 3, which was trained on a set of 15 trillion tokens. But as AI models grow larger, the diminishing returns from scaling up become apparent. Simply put, continuing to make models larger or reducing their precision indefinitely may not lead to better outcomes.

In practice, this means that reducing the precision of a model too much — say, beyond 7 or 8 bits — can significantly degrade its performance. As AI models become more sophisticated, maintaining accuracy becomes increasingly difficult if the precision of model parameters is reduced too much.

Precision and Its Role in AI Models

AI models are usually trained using 16-bit or “half-precision” formats. After training, models are often quantized to 8-bit precision for more efficient inference. However, certain components of a model may not tolerate very low precision. As the model’s precision drops, the accuracy of its predictions may suffer.

Nvidia, a major player in the AI hardware space, is pushing for lower precision in model inference. Their Blackwell chip supports 4-bit precision, which they claim reduces memory and power consumption. But for most models, the gains from using such low precision may not outweigh the performance loss.

The Future of AI Model Efficiency

To overcome the limitations of quantization, AI researchers are exploring new techniques. One promising direction is training models with low precision from the start. According to Tanishq Kumar, a key author of a study on quantization, models trained with low precision can be more robust to the effects of quantization. This approach may lead to more efficient AI models without sacrificing too much accuracy.

Another possible solution is better data curation. Instead of training models on vast amounts of data, AI companies might focus on filtering and selecting the highest quality data. This could allow smaller models to perform well without the need for extreme quantization.

The Bottom Line

While quantization has been an essential tool in AI for reducing costs and improving efficiency, it has its limits. The trade-offs associated with quantizing large models are becoming more apparent. As AI labs continue to scale up their models, they may need to reconsider their reliance on quantization.

In the future, AI models may rely on new architectures designed specifically to make low precision training more stable. As the AI field progresses, researchers will need to strike a balance between model size, precision, and performance to ensure that AI continues to improve without sacrificing quality.

Conclusion

Quantization remains a critical technique in making AI models more efficient. However, its effectiveness is reaching its limits. AI researchers and companies must look beyond traditional quantization methods and explore new ways to improve model performance. As AI continues to evolve, the next generation of models will likely focus on smarter, more efficient ways of handling data.


Source: https://techcrunch.com/2024/12/23/a-popular-technique-to-make-ai-more-efficient-has-drawbacks/

Souce: https://thesperks.com/chinas-revolutionary-open-source-ai-model-outperforms-industry-leaders/

Comments

No comments yet. Why don’t you start the discussion?

Leave a Reply

Your email address will not be published. Required fields are marked *